Barbados Labour Party apologises for `white people’ remark

(Barbados Nation) The hierarchy of the Barbados Labour Party (BLP) yesterday apologized for comments made  by one of its members Wednesday night in the House of Assembly.

The apology came from St Andrew parliamentary representative and BLP chairman George Payne after the House returned from a break.

It came in the wake of utterances by St George North MP Gline Clarke who, said Payne, had been speaking about the pending arrangement “between the Democratic Labour Party Government and the Barbados Motoring Club”.

“In order to identify which club is the club that [Finance Minister Christopher Sinckler] should have been dealing with, he did indicate, although it was not very clear, that it was the club dealing with the white people,” said Payne.
